Hatboro-Horsham Senior Honored at Eastern

Hatboro-Horsham High School senior Irvin Romero was chosen as the December student of the month at Eastern Center for Arts and Technology.

Irvin Romero is the December 2012 Student of the Month at Eastern Center for Arts and Technology in Willow Grove. He is in his second year of Eastern's Collision Repair Technology program and a senior at Hatboro-Horsham High School.

At Eastern, Irvin maintains an A average and is actively involved in SkillsUSA as the 2012-2013 SkillsUSA Collision Repair Technology class president.

SkillsUSA is a national student organization promoting good citizenship, student leadership, professionalism, teamwork, and recognizes student achievement and excellence.

Last May, as a junior, Irvin was recognized at Eastern’s awards night with the Straight A Award and the Director’s Award. Last summer, he volunteered his time to student teach for the Intro to Automotive and Collision Repair Summer Fun program at Eastern. Irvin also volunteers at the Union Library of Hatboro every Tuesday. He played football for Hatboro-Horsham High School, and soccer for the Hatboro Heat Soccer Club.

“Irvin is dedicated to his future profession,” said Steve Parke, Eastern’s Collision Repair Technology instructor. “He is focused, hard-working and professional. I have no doubt that he will achieve all of the goals he has set for himself.”

Irvin intends to become an automotive refinisher. He is currently deciding between Universal Technical Institute or WyoTech to continue his collision repair education.

The Student of the Month Award is sponsored by Eastern’s faculty, joint committee and the Willow Grove Rotary Club to highlight student excellence, success and service. Each year, 10 students are selected for this honor.
